Uniform Title Mercurius Britannicus. English.
Title Mercurius Britanicus, : or The English intelligencer. A tragic-comedy, at Paris. Acted with great applause.
Alternative Title English intelligencer
Caption Title The censure of the iudges : or, the court cure
Publication Info [London : s.n.], Printed in the yeare, 1641.



Descript [36] p.
Note Anonymous; attributed to Richard Brathwait.
A political satire on the ship-money controversy.
Place of publication from Wing.
Signatures: A-D⁴ E² .
The earliest of the English editions published in 1641. "The second edition collates: A-C⁴ D² ; ... in it the Epilogue is omitted. The third collates: A⁴ a² B-C⁴ D² ; the first half-sheet contains a printer's note to the Reader, Praeludium and Prologue, and the Epilogue is restored."--Pforzheimer Catalogue.
Also published in Latin in the same year.
Reproduction of the original in the British Library.
